Ok, so if any of you listened to the news last week, a little town in illinois had a close encounter with a F4 tornado.
If you dont understand the fugita scale of rating tornados, an F4 is just shy of the finger of god. So this thing passes 3/4 mile from my house as im sitting out in my boat fishing in northern wisconsin. Shortly later i get a call asking if the house is alright and im confused as to what might be wrong with it. So they go on to explain to me what the tornado did.

The thing started up about 7 miles due west of my house. proceded to 3 miles west and a half mile south to destroy a 225000 sq factory with 150 people huddled in the reinforced bathrooms... and were not talkin run over the factory... no, it stalled and sat there for 14 min before completely destroying 3 houses due east and severely damaging 2 others. then it moved 1/4 mile south and ran just south of the town before it beat up a few more houses and finally disapated. Enclosed are some pics... ill post more as i get them...

Needless to say, my vacation got cut short, and i spent the rest of it trying to help my neighbors find thier belongings in the fields.
